Trout Sugar Cookies Recipe
Ingredients:
No Fail Sugar Cookie Recipe
• Trout Cookie Cutter (SKU: 4201-OR-FS-2)
• Royal Icing Mix (SKU: 6750-IC-RI-1)
• 8 oz Squeeze Bottles (SKU: 160000018-1) or pastry bags
• Parchment Paper
• Tootpicks
• Assorted shades of food coloring

Makes: Approximately 2 dozen fish cookies

Instructions:
• Make cookie dough according to recipe. Cut out several trout cookie shapes. Place on parchment paper. Bake and cool as directed.
• While cookies are cooling make icing. Mix according to directions. To thin, add small amounts of water. One large drop at a time. Mix thoroughly until consistency is between heavy cream and ketchup.
• Flavor icing if desired with lemon or almond oil or extract.
• Divide icing out into several small bowls (depending on how many different colors you want). Dye each bowl of icing desired color. Pour icing into squeeze bottles or pastry bags.
• Ice base layer of cookies.
• To create marble effect, ice base layer color, then add a few lines drops of a different color onto the wet icing. Marble the two colors together with a toothpick. You can use multiple colors with this effect.
• Let initial layer of icing dry to touch (30-45 minutes). Add second layer of icing to create 3D effect and to add any details (eyes, fins, etc).
• Let cookies completely dry on parchment paper (overnight is best). Stack and store in an airtight container.
